Popovers in a Muffin Pan

Popovers in a Muffin Pan

Prep Time 45 minutes
Total Time 45 minutes
Course Breads, Others
Servings 12 popovers

Ingredients
  

  • 5 tbs melted butter
  • 2 eggs
  • 1 cup milk
  • 1 tsp salt
  • 1 cup all-purpose flour
  • 1 tsp fresh thyme or 1/2 tsp dried, optional

Instructions
 

  • Preheat oven to 425 degrees. Drizzle a teaspoon or so of melted butter in each cup of a 12-cup muffin pan or a popover tin and put it in the oven while you make the batter.
  • Beat together the eggs, milk, 1 tablespoon butter, sugar, and salt. Beat in the flour a little bit at a time and add thyme if using; mixture should be smooth.
  • Carefully remove muffin tin from the oven and fill each cup about halfway. Bake for 15 to 20 minutes, then reduce heat to 350 degrees and continue baking for 15 minutes more, or until popovers are puffed and browned. Do not check popovers until they have baked for a total of 30 minutes. Remove from pan immediately and serve hot.
